The IS login is being used through iStock's API which allows third-party developers to come up with helpful tools such as DeepMeta and a bunch of others. It does not allow the third party to collect or observe your log-in information. You can read more about it here: http://www.istockphoto.com/forum_messages.php?threadid=46006&page=1 (http://www.istockphoto.com/forum_messages.php?threadid=46006&page=1) and see the full list of available apps in that same forum.
